After a short rest after the meal, the team leader led everyone to do some preparations and started to head to the entrance of the Black Hole Waterfalls. We went up along the waterfalls, crossing the water when we encountered it and climbing the slopes when we encountered them.
The first waterfall, Black Hole Waterfall, rises several feet and cascades down the rocky cliffs. Its impressive momentum is unparalleled, like a white smelting cliff, splashing white lotuses. At the bottom of the valley, a deep pool shimmers, and a stream flows through the gorge (the entire route is 3.5 kilometers, with a drop of over 80 meters, and the water is crystal clear.). It's a relaxing and tireless loop.

After breakfast, we headed to the entrance of the Wuyue Ancient Trail. After a brief warm-up, we ascended along the trail until we reached the summit, where the view suddenly opened up to a breathtaking vista. At 1,140 meters above sea level, the Tianchi Lake in western Zhejiang appeared before the tourists. Spanning thousands of hectares and surrounded by towering mountains, the lake is a breathtaking alpine wonder, akin to a vast divine pond, akin to a celestial realm floating in the sky. We paused for a moment to take as many photos as we could.
